What is an All States M.E.D. franchisee required to do to assist the franchisor in obtaining intellectual property rights?

As Franchisor may reasonably request, Franchisee shall take all actions to assist Franchisor's efforts to obtain or maintain intellectual property rights in any item or process related to the System, whether developed by Franchisee or not.

Source: Item 23 — RECEIPTS (FDD pages 44–174)

According to the 2024 All States M.E.D. Franchise Disclosure Document, franchisees are obligated to assist All States M.E.D. in securing and maintaining its intellectual property rights related to the All States M.E.D. system. This encompasses any item or process linked to the All States M.E.D. system, irrespective of whether the franchisee developed it.

All ideas, concepts, techniques, or materials concerning the All States M.E.D. system, or developed using trade secrets or confidential information, are deemed the sole property of All States M.E.D.. This applies whether or not such developments are protectable intellectual property and regardless of who created them (franchisee, owners, or employees). Franchisees must promptly disclose such developments to All States M.E.D. and agree to assign all rights to any intellectual property developed to All States M.E.D.

In practice, this means that if a franchisee innovates or improves any aspect of the All States M.E.D. system, they must transfer ownership of that innovation to All States M.E.D. and take any requested actions to help All States M.E.D. protect it. This is a fairly standard clause in franchise agreements, as franchisors need to maintain control over their brand's intellectual property. Franchisees do not receive additional compensation for these developments, as the FDD states that no compensation is due to the franchisee or its owners/employees.
